Our episode of @TheWeekly about the crisis in the taxi industry is just starting on @FXNetworks. I’m watching with the cabby who we focus on in the episode — Mohammad Hossain. #TheWeeklyNYTpic.twitter.com/7suUkKdoxz
Mohammad and his wife and daughter are all getting emotional as we watch the episode. They say it's weird to see themselves on television, but they're glad that people are seeing what they've been going through. "I hope my bank is watching," Mohammad said. #TheWeeklyNYT
Mohammad is one of almost 200 taxi medallion owners who we interviewed while investigating the taxi industry. @EmmaGF, @Hillingers and I met owner-drivers from Bangladesh, Egypt, Peru, Romania, Israel, Pakistan and many other countries. #TheWeeklyNYT
On the other hand, almost all the bankers and brokers & fleet owners declined to talk with us. The people who are interviewed in the episode - Larry Fisher, Basil Messados - are not necessarily the worst in the industry. They're the ones who agreed to go on camera. #TheWeeklyNYT
Taxi driver Mohammad Hossain, watching the bankers, brokers and regulators who we interviewed in our @TheWeekly episode on the cab industry: "They all blame each other." #TheWeeklyNYT
One of the most striking parts of the episode is the footage from the television commercial that the city produced ahead of its medallion auctions (a "once-in-a-lifetime opportunity," the commercial said). That ad aired in 2004, and it took months to track it down. #TheWeeklyNYT
